Transaction 15fe74111816a1123a17b8b59e306a9f82807b5c35e4fc818c9ed32c2de39e58

1 Input
2 Outputs
  • 15fe74111816a1123a17b8b59e306a9f82807b5c35e4fc818c9ed32c2de39e58:0
  • value  1650104
    address  2Mykgn2iLL26KarWSLLf7aTKQApbW9htmrs
  • 15fe74111816a1123a17b8b59e306a9f82807b5c35e4fc818c9ed32c2de39e58:1
  • value  6018733060
    address  2NA3VzyotsRVQfiB8FSXmXNCVCJss2RCyj9